Abstract

Using the shell model we evaluate the splitting among the levels of light nuclei with 6 or 14 nucleons. The introduced interactions are the spin-orbit couplings of every nucleon in the field of the residual nucleus, the central force and the tensor force between the external nucleons in order to calculate the influence of the last one on the order and the distance of the levels. The results obtained show that at least in this particular case this influence is not negligible. Wishing to compare our deductions with those ofInglis (1) (who used only central forces) we may say that in the case considered by us the introduction of these new kinds of interactions does not lead to a better agreement with experiment.
